```This is a review and comparison of Schiit Lyr tube Headphone amplifier to Schiit Magni 3. The Schiit Lyr is on kind loan from a member. It is discontinued but seems to have retailed for US $450 (replaced with Schiit Lyr 2). The Schiit Magni 3 which is a solid-state headphone amplifier retails for $99 so quite a bit cheaper.```
```My personal reference headphone system is Stax SRM-007t which is differential tube amplifier. So I don't have a bias against tube audio in general. In this case though, for the life of me I can't figure out why anyone would want to buy the Schiit Lyr. Yes, it has more power due to higher output voltage but it also produces copious amount of measured distortion and some audible one. Combine that with much higher cost and cost of ownership in tubes and it just makes no sense to me.
